A 48DS-type 4wDM not recorded as existing in any of the usual lists of surviving locos, has been rescued from Redden’s scrapyard, Wellingborough, by Lawrie Rose.
This is Ruston & Hornsby 393303 delivered to Wagon Repairs Ltd, Branston Works, Burton-on-Trent on January 20, 1956. It has lingered in the scrapyard for many years and generally believed to have been scrapped in fairly recent times.
It was initially purchased by Lawrie to recover its wheel sets for his other similar loco, the fully restored 294266, the former Bill McAlpine loco now based on the Mid-Suffolk Railway. This needs replacement tyres fitted and this was believed to be the most cost-effective way.
However, on inspection, 393303 was found to be substantially complete, so the plan is for it to be restored. Work started immediately, but with the wheels transferred to the other loco.
